From Edmonds article: "The question remains whether the G37 Sport will match the acceleration of the BMW 335i, which hits 60 mph in only 4.8 seconds and trounces the quarter-mile in 13.3 seconds at almost 106 mph. Our seat-of-the-pants assessment says that the G37 isn't quite up to that task, due mostly to its torque deficit, fewer gears (the Bimmer has a six-speed automatic) and heavier estimated weight (3,682 pounds vs. 3,571 pounds)."
"But anytime the going gets twisty and you're driving in the upper reaches of the power band, the G will leave the 3 Series in its wake with better top-end punch and a more performance-focused chassis." So they think this new G, although not able to keep up with the TT from standstill will out perform it in the area where BMW is king?? WTF. I will wait and see!!

Once again, Infiniti gives the G the same ole 5AT tranny...bleh ; it's not nearly as refined, smooth, and fast-shifting as the 335i's 6AT ZF tranny. In addition, even though this new G37 with its increased displacement has ~ 330BHP, it's TQ is still way below 300 lb.-ft. of TQ...why can't Nissan/Infiniti get the TQ to over 300 lb.-ft. TQ on the NA VQ engine?
The design is so similar to the G35 Sedan (which I like for the most part), and the interior is much improved than previous gen G35, but it's nothing like the Concept. One thing that I was surprised about in the Edmunds review was how impressed they were with the new G37's handling and road feel...better than the BMW 335i...really? I'm glad I didn't wait for the G37 Coupe; not too interested, and I believe a stock 335i will still be faster than the G37.
